Montreal Canadiens celebrate 2022 draft as Zharovsky trade rumors emerge
The Montreal Canadiens' 2022 NHL Entry Draft, highlighted by taking forward Juraj Slafkovsky first overall, is praised after the Slovakian winger posted career‑high numbers in the 2025‑26 season – 30 goals, 43 assists and 73 points – and secured a key role on the team's top line.
At the recent trade deadline, reports suggested the Canadiens nearly dealt Russian prospect Alexander Zharovsky, a highly regarded 2022‑draft pick whose rights remain with the club. Agent Dan Milstein neither confirmed nor denied the talk, noting that discussions fell through and the player will stay in the Canadiens' system for the time being.
